Output 29e2694e6106fc4c0d42097df565515ea5a8e9ebb1dcdbe592711d8d1ae06357:4

value
1284533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a86d182e74dae23116390e93ce090a0c1e8bde22 OP_EQUAL
address
3H3a8ncEgfnLCRbG2ChJZZ9V6fpJ7eTVe3
transaction
29e2694e6106fc4c0d42097df565515ea5a8e9ebb1dcdbe592711d8d1ae06357
spent
true